Photoshop Ruler Tool
Photoshop Ruler Tool
In photoshop Rulers, the measure tool, guides, and grids help you position images or elements precisely across the width or length of an image.
Photoshop Rulers: To display or hide rulers, Choose View > Show Rulers or Hide Rulers. When visible, rulers appear along the top and left side of the active window.
You can change the rulers' zero origin by dragging diagonally down onto the image. The ruler origin also determines the grid's point of origin. To snap the ruler origin to guidelines or gridlines, choose View > Snap to Guides or View > Snap to Grid, before dragging.
To reset the ruler origin to its default value, double-click the upper left corner (origin) of the rulers.
Changing the rulers' settings:
1. Choose File > Preferences > Units & Rulers to open preference window.
2. In the preference window, choose a unit of measurement.
3 .For Width and Gutter, enter values for the column size. You also can change the units.
4. For Point/Pica Size, choose PostScript (72 points per inch) if you are printing to a PostScript device OR Traditional to use printer's 72.27 points per inch.
